ext4: Add new tracepoints to debug delayed allocation space functions



Add tracepoints for ext4_da_reserve_space(),
ext4_da_update_reserve_space(), and ext4_da_release_space().

TRACE_EVENT(ext4_da_update_reserve_space,
	TP_PROTO(struct inode *inode, int used_blocks),

	TP_ARGS(inode, used_blocks),

	TP_STRUCT__entry(
		__field(	dev_t,	dev			)
		__field(	ino_t,	ino			)
		__field(	umode_t, mode			)
		__field(	__u64,	i_blocks		)
		__field(	int,	used_blocks		)
		__field(	int,	reserved_data_blocks	)
		__field(	int,	reserved_meta_blocks	)
		__field(	int,	allocated_meta_blocks	)
	),

	TP_fast_assign(
		__entry->dev	= inode->i_sb->s_dev;
		__entry->ino	= inode->i_ino;
		__entry->mode	= inode->i_mode;
		__entry->i_blocks = inode->i_blocks;
		__entry->used_blocks = used_blocks;
		__entry->reserved_data_blocks = EXT4_I(inode)->i_reserved_data_blocks;
		__entry->reserved_meta_blocks = EXT4_I(inode)->i_reserved_meta_blocks;
		__entry->allocated_meta_blocks = EXT4_I(inode)->i_allocated_meta_blocks;
	),

	TP_printk("dev %s ino %lu mode 0%o i_blocks %llu used_blocks %d reserved_data_blocks %d reserved_meta_blocks %d allocated_meta_blocks %d",
		  jbd2_dev_to_name(__entry->dev), (unsigned long) __entry->ino,
		  __entry->mode,  (unsigned long long) __entry->i_blocks,
		  __entry->used_blocks, __entry->reserved_data_blocks,
		  __entry->reserved_meta_blocks, __entry->allocated_meta_blocks)
);

TRACE_EVENT(ext4_da_reserve_space,
	TP_PROTO(struct inode *inode, int md_needed),

	TP_ARGS(inode, md_needed),

	TP_STRUCT__entry(
		__field(	dev_t,	dev			)
		__field(	ino_t,	ino			)
		__field(	umode_t, mode			)
		__field(	__u64,	i_blocks		)
		__field(	int,	md_needed		)
		__field(	int,	reserved_data_blocks	)
		__field(	int,	reserved_meta_blocks	)
	),

	TP_fast_assign(
		__entry->dev	= inode->i_sb->s_dev;
		__entry->ino	= inode->i_ino;
		__entry->mode	= inode->i_mode;
		__entry->i_blocks = inode->i_blocks;
		__entry->md_needed = md_needed;
		__entry->reserved_data_blocks = EXT4_I(inode)->i_reserved_data_blocks;
		__entry->reserved_meta_blocks = EXT4_I(inode)->i_reserved_meta_blocks;
	),

	TP_printk("dev %s ino %lu mode 0%o i_blocks %llu md_needed %d reserved_data_blocks %d reserved_meta_blocks %d",
		  jbd2_dev_to_name(__entry->dev), (unsigned long) __entry->ino,
		  __entry->mode, (unsigned long long) __entry->i_blocks,
		  __entry->md_needed, __entry->reserved_data_blocks,
		  __entry->reserved_meta_blocks)
);

TRACE_EVENT(ext4_da_release_space,
	TP_PROTO(struct inode *inode, int freed_blocks),

	TP_ARGS(inode, freed_blocks),

	TP_STRUCT__entry(
		__field(	dev_t,	dev			)
		__field(	ino_t,	ino			)
		__field(	umode_t, mode			)
		__field(	__u64,	i_blocks		)
		__field(	int,	freed_blocks		)
		__field(	int,	reserved_data_blocks	)
		__field(	int,	reserved_meta_blocks	)
		__field(	int,	allocated_meta_blocks	)
	),

	TP_fast_assign(
		__entry->dev	= inode->i_sb->s_dev;
		__entry->ino	= inode->i_ino;
		__entry->mode	= inode->i_mode;
		__entry->i_blocks = inode->i_blocks;
		__entry->freed_blocks = freed_blocks;
		__entry->reserved_data_blocks = EXT4_I(inode)->i_reserved_data_blocks;
		__entry->reserved_meta_blocks = EXT4_I(inode)->i_reserved_meta_blocks;
		__entry->allocated_meta_blocks = EXT4_I(inode)->i_allocated_meta_blocks;
	),

	TP_printk("dev %s ino %lu mode 0%o i_blocks %llu freed_blocks %d reserved_data_blocks %d reserved_meta_blocks %d allocated_meta_blocks %d",
		  jbd2_dev_to_name(__entry->dev), (unsigned long) __entry->ino,
		  __entry->mode, (unsigned long long) __entry->i_blocks,
		  __entry->freed_blocks, __entry->reserved_data_blocks,
		  __entry->reserved_meta_blocks, __entry->allocated_meta_blocks)
);
